Google is celebrating the International Women’s Day with an interactive doodle video on search engines across the world.
The doodle plays a video of women from all over the world greeting a Happy International Women’s Day. The doodle will be run from March 7 to 9 at the Google homepage.
International Women’s Day is celebrated yearly every 8th of March.
The women include 16-year-old Pakistani education and women’s rights activist Malala Yousafzai, Australian photographer and women’s advocate Anne Geddes, and Indian five-time World Boxing champion Mary Kom.
Also featured are the first Filipinas to climb Mount Everest Noelle Wenceslao, Janet Belarmino and Carina Dayodon, and social advocate and lead mobilizer of Rescue PH Rosario San Juan.
